In Photos: Impressive Statues You Should Visit 

The cityscape of Sendai, Japan, with the 330-foot-tall (100-meter-tall) Sendai Daikannon in the distance, viewed from Mount Aoba.

B-hide the scene / Shutterstock

The 325-foot-tall (99-meter-tall) Guishan Guanyin of the Thousand Hands and Eyes, photographed in Miyin Temple in Weishan, Changsha, China.

Provided by Atlantic Media Company

<123 4 56>

Related Articles More from author

Leave A Reply

Your email address will not be published.